Answer:
C) 9.56 L
Step-by-step explanation:
Equation for the ideal gas:
PV=nRT
so, V= (nRT)/P......1
Here,
n=1.90 moles
R= .0821 Latmmol-1k-1
T=31.8+273= 304.8 K [T(un kelvin scale)=t(in celcius scale)+273]
P= 4.972 atm
Now from eq 1 we can determine the volume of the gas or tank V, which is 9.56 L(option C)
